Toyota Prius Is A Very Popular Hybrid car.
The best selling and most popular hybrid car in the world right now is once again the Toyota Prius. When the Prius was released back in 1997 it pioneered the trend towards hybrid vehicles.
The Prius sold very poorly at first, but sales picked up when new models came on the market. In 2003 Toyota came out with their second generation hybrid vehicle making it car of the year according to Motor Trend.

Many improvements have been made to the latest hybrid vehicles. The first generation Toyota Prius was fuel efficient but it only had the additional option of air-conditioning. The second generation vehicle improved on the first in aesthetics, speed, and size. Of the midsize hatchback sedans in the marketplace, it’s the first one to have won multiple awards.
This hybrid car uses the Synergy hybrid system which is used by all hybrid vehicles that Toyota manufactures. It uses a 1.5-liter, 4-cylinder engines features intelligent valve timing and an AC synchronous, permanent magnet motor. It has 110 horsepower (combining electric power with gas power) and 46 mpg fuel economy (shared city and highway ranking by EPA).
It has an electronically controlled continuous variable transmission, anti-lock system and regenerative breaking. It has up to 89 % less emissions and grants the owner a tax credit upon purchase.
The standard features of the second generation Toyota Prius are power windows, cloth seating, micron filter air-conditioning, electric door locks, cruise control and remote keyless entry. The climate, radio, and cruise control can be adjusted remotely though switches on the steering wheel.
The Bluetooth Navigational system is one of the options customers have when buying the vehicle. What makes it different from any other hybrids on the market is that it uses a power button to start the ingition rather than a key. On the dashboard is an energy motor that monitors the power that flows through the battery pack, engine and electric motor.
